We may earn an affiliate commission when you visit our partners.

Google Cloud Platform (GCP)

Save
May 1, 2024 Updated June 26, 2025 19 minute read

Navigating the World of Google Cloud Platform (GCP)

Google Cloud Platform, or GCP, is a suite of cloud computing services offered by Google that runs on the same infrastructure that Google uses internally for its end-user products, such as Google Search, Gmail, and YouTube. It provides a series of modular cloud services including computing, data storage, data analytics, and machine learning, alongside a set of management tools. Essentially, GCP allows businesses, developers, and organizations of all sizes to build, launch, and manage their applications and online services by accessing Google's powerful global infrastructure.

Path to Google Cloud Platform (GCP)

Take the first step.
We've curated 24 courses to help you on your path to Google Cloud Platform (GCP). Use these to develop your skills, build background knowledge, and put what you learn to practice.
Sorted from most relevant to least relevant:

Share

Help others find this page about Google Cloud Platform (GCP): by sharing it with your friends and followers:

Reading list

We've selected 22 books that we think will supplement your learning. Use these to develop background knowledge, enrich your coursework, and gain a deeper understanding of the topics covered in Google Cloud Platform (GCP).
A comprehensive guide for the Professional Cloud Security Engineer certification, this book delves into GCP security concepts, best practices, and services. It's a crucial resource for understanding how to secure workloads and data on GCP and is valuable for professionals focused on cloud security.
Is specifically designed for those preparing for the Professional Cloud Network Engineer certification. It covers GCP networking concepts, design, and implementation in detail. It's a highly relevant resource for anyone specializing in GCP networking.
Is specifically tailored for architects and engineers who are responsible for designing and managing GCP solutions. It covers topics such as cloud architecture patterns, security best practices, and performance optimization.
This widely recognized study guide for the Professional Cloud Architect certification. It covers a comprehensive range of topics relevant to designing and planning cloud solution architecture on GCP. It is often used as a primary resource for those preparing for the certification exam.
Another comprehensive guide for the Professional Cloud Architect certification, offering a different perspective and potentially complementary information to other study guides. It covers the exam syllabus and helps users prepare for the certification. Useful for reinforcing knowledge and exploring topics from various angles.
Focuses on applying DevOps principles and Site Reliability Engineering (SRE) practices on GCP. It's particularly relevant for those interested in the operational aspects of managing applications on the platform and preparing for the Professional Cloud DevOps Engineer certification. It covers CI/CD, monitoring, and other key DevOps areas.
A more advanced book focusing on specific aspects of Google Kubernetes Engine (GKE), including networking, security, monitoring, and automation. It's valuable for users who need to deepen their understanding of GKE's advanced features and configurations for production environments.
A practical guide focused on data engineering on GCP, covering services like BigQuery, Cloud Dataflow, and Cloud Composer. It's valuable for those looking to build and manage data pipelines on the platform. It includes hands-on examples for implementing ETL/ELT processes.
Delves into the AI and Machine Learning services offered by GCP. It's ideal for those who want to apply AI/ML in their projects using GCP's capabilities. It covers practical aspects of utilizing these services.
Follow-up to the author's previous book on GCP and covers more advanced topics such as serverless computing, Bigtable, Cloud Spanner, and Anthos. It is recommended for those who have a solid understanding of GCP basics.
Explores DevOps practices on GCP, focusing on tools like Docker, Jenkins, and Kubernetes. It provides practical guidance for implementing CI/CD pipelines and managing applications on GCP using these technologies. It's suitable for developers and architects interested in practical DevOps implementation.
Aims to be a comprehensive resource for mastering GCP, covering a wide range of services and topics including architecture, data management, machine learning, and security. It is presented as a guide for IT professionals, developers, and cloud enthusiasts seeking to leverage the full potential of GCP.
Focuses on developing cloud-native applications on GCP, covering relevant services and practices. It's valuable for developers looking to build modern, scalable applications on the platform. It likely covers topics like containers, microservices, and serverless.
A practical guide offering hands-on solutions for implementing, deploying, and maintaining applications on GCP. is valuable as a reference tool for tackling specific tasks and configurations within the platform. It provides a recipe-based approach to common challenges.
Provides a broad overview of Google Cloud Platform services, making it excellent for gaining a general understanding. It includes practical examples and insights into how things work under the hood. While not the most recent publication, it's still a valuable resource for foundational knowledge.
Is an excellent starting point for learning Kubernetes specifically on GCP. It covers the basics of deploying and managing applications using GKE. It's suitable for beginners with some programming knowledge and provides a hands-on approach.
While not exclusively about GCP, this book highly regarded resource for understanding Kubernetes, which fundamental technology for container orchestration on GCP (GKE). It provides in-depth knowledge applicable to running containerized applications on GCP. This is essential for anyone working with GKE.
This guide aims to provide a broad introduction to a wide range of GCP services, including compute, storage, database, and networking. It's suitable for those new to GCP who want to get familiar with the platform's offerings. It also touches upon Big Data and AI/ML services.
Provides a foundational understanding of cloud computing concepts, technology, and architecture. It's an excellent resource for gaining prerequisite knowledge before diving deep into a specific cloud platform like GCP. It covers fundamental principles applicable across all cloud providers.
Provides a technical overview of cloud computing, including public and private cloud technologies and migration strategies. It helps in understanding the broader cloud landscape and the technical considerations for adopting cloud services like GCP. It covers implementation details for migrating applications.
While a general cloud computing book, it provides valuable insights into architectural design decisions applicable to any cloud platform, including GCP. It helps in understanding the considerations for choosing different cloud service models. Useful for gaining a broader architectural perspective.
This business novel that illustrates the principles of DevOps and IT operations. While not technical, it provides valuable context for understanding the cultural and organizational changes associated with adopting cloud and DevOps practices on platforms like GCP. It's a classic in the DevOps space.
Table of Contents
Our mission

OpenCourser helps millions of learners each year. People visit us to learn workspace skills, ace their exams, and nurture their curiosity.

Our extensive catalog contains over 50,000 courses and twice as many books. Browse by search, by topic, or even by career interests. We'll match you to the right resources quickly.

Find this site helpful? Tell a friend about us.

Affiliate disclosure

We're supported by our community of learners. When you purchase or subscribe to courses and programs or purchase books, we may earn a commission from our partners.

Your purchases help us maintain our catalog and keep our servers humming without ads.

Thank you for supporting OpenCourser.

© 2016 - 2025 OpenCourser